Ryan Pearson (who was the first reporter to interview me, and has subsequently posted several stories about or mentioning Snakes on a Plane) interviewed director David Ellis and screenwriter John Heffernan and put together a few plot and casting details that appear to be new. For example, Samuel L. Jackson’s role was originally envisioned for a younger actor (Taye Diggs or Blair Underwood). There’s also a short audio clip from the film’s composer discussing the difficulties of doing audio for the film, and this picture of David Ellis:
